1970 holds the record for the coldest King’s Day
Since the celebration of King’s Day began in the Netherlands, only the 2020 edition has been consistently warm, sunny, and dry. The coldest King’s Day ever recorded occurred in 1970. Temperatures in De Bilt that day reached only 8.6 degrees, and the sun failed to appear at any point during the day, according to weeronline.
